タグ

2014年10月21日のブックマーク (6件)

  • 【頭の回転が速い】と言われる人々の共通点とは...? - 旅JUMPER

    急に何かを言われると、モノゴトを理解して答えを出すために数秒かかってしまう…。多くの人はそんな経験をしたことがあるのではないだろうか。 しかし、何を言われてもすぐに返すことが出来る。突拍子の無いことでも、自分なりに意見をすぐに言える。そんな人々に出会ったことはないだろうか?俗に言う《頭の回転が速い人々》だ。 彼らはナゼ周りの人よりも頭の回転が速いのか?共通点は彼らの日常生活にあった…。 ———————————————————————————————————————— 普段の生活、あなたはどのように過ごしているだろうか。 朝起きて支度をして、ショッピングをしたり友達ランチをしたり、はたまたカフェで読書かカラオケなどに行くのだろうか? 頭の回転が速い人々もあなたと特に変わらない生活を送っている。いわゆる一般的な生活だ。しかし日常生活に取り入れている小さなことが、2つの間に大きな違いを生んでい

    【頭の回転が速い】と言われる人々の共通点とは...? - 旅JUMPER
  • SymPy

    SymPy is a Python library for symbolic mathematics. It aims to become a full-featured computer algebra system (CAS) while keeping the code as simple as possible in order to be comprehensible and easily extensible. SymPy is written entirely in Python. Get started with the tutorial Download Now SymPy is… Free: Licensed under BSD, SymPy is free both as in speech and as in beer. Python-based: SymPy is

  • 天文物理学向け計算に特化したPython JITコンパイラ「HOPE」 | OSDN Magazine

    チューリッヒ工科大学(ETH)の天文学研究所が、PythonコードをC++コードに変換してコンパイルするツール「HOPE」を公開した。天文学に関連する機能のみに特化したツールで、PythonC++を組み合わせることでプログラミングの容易さを保ちつつ天文物理学の計算に要求される性能を実現するとしている。 HOPEは、チューリッヒ工科大の天文学研究所内のソフトウェアラボで開発されたコンパイラ。Pythonで実装されており、PythonコードをC++に変換およびコンパイルして実行できる。実行時にコンパイルを行うJITJust In Time)型のコンパイラで、関数単位でのコンパイルを行う「method-at-a-time」型のアーキテクチャを持つ。ライセンスはGPLv3。 ほかのPython実行環境と異なる点として、HOPEは天体物理学で必要とされる計算に特化している点が挙げられている。Py

    天文物理学向け計算に特化したPython JITコンパイラ「HOPE」 | OSDN Magazine
  • Apple、iOSアプリの64ビット対応を義務付けへ 2015年2月から

    Appleは10月20日(現地時間)、アプリ開発者に対し、2015年2月1日からApp Storeに登録するiOSアプリをすべて64ビット対応にするよう通告した。既存アプリもアップデートの際に64ビット対応にする必要がある。 また、アプリの構築にはiOS 8 SDKを使うことも義務付けた。64ビットに対応させるには、Xcodeを使うことを推奨している。 Appleによると、現行のアプリの64ビット版への移行は“シームレスに”行えるという。 64ビットプロセッサのA7あるいはA8を搭載するiOS 7以降の端末では64ビット対応アプリの利用が可能だ。App Storeのアプリの多くが64ビット対応になれば、これまでより快適にアプリを利用できるだろう。 なお、米GoogleのモバイルOSであるAndroidは、近くリリースされる「Android 5.0 Lollipop」から64ビットに対応す

    Apple、iOSアプリの64ビット対応を義務付けへ 2015年2月から
  • Emacs 24.4リリース!ファーストインプレッション | るびきち「日刊Emacs」

    今日、1年半ぶりにEmacsの新バージョン(24.4)がリリースされたので、 さっそくインストールしてみました。 注意すべき点は大きくわけて3つです。 パッケージでエラーになるので回避方法 Emacs組み込みWebブラウザEWW! ついにバイトコンパイル問題に決着! ビルド 僕のところのconfigureビルドオプションはこんな感じです。 $ wget -O- http://ftp.gnu.org/gnu/emacs/emacs-24.4.tar.xz | tar xJvf - $ cd emacs-24.4 $ ./configure --disable-largefile --with-x-toolkit=motif --without-toolkit-scroll-bars \ --without-xaw3d --without-xim --without-compres

  • Objective-Cより柔軟な新プログラミング言語「Swift」をはじめよう!~開発環境の構築とプロジェクトの作成

    連載では、Objective-Cの基的なプログラムが出来る読者を対象に、Swiftを使ってアプリを開発する際の基的な事柄を解説します。Objective-CもSwiftもC言語を母体としたプログラム言語なので両者に共通する概念は非常に多いです。Objective-CとSwiftとの最低限度の違いを踏まえつつ、Swiftでのアプリ開発にシフトして行けるような内容を、サンプルを交えながら解説します。 はじめに 連載第1回目では、Swiftを使って開発を行う際に必要なツール類と、Swiftのプログラムを試す環境の構築について説明します。Objective-C経験者が初めてSwiftに触れることを前提として、開発環境の構築とSwiftの特徴について説明します。 対象読者をObjective-Cが分かる方としている関係上、Objective-C自体の言語仕様やXcodeの使い方については解説を

    Objective-Cより柔軟な新プログラミング言語「Swift」をはじめよう!~開発環境の構築とプロジェクトの作成